About the course:
The petroleum refining training course covers the technology aspects you need to know about refineries from the properties and composition of crude oil to the core refining processes including atmospheric and vacuum crude oil distillation, hydrotreating, catalytic reforming, FCC, alkylation, hydrocracking, delayed coking, amine treating and Sulphur recovery and gasoline/diesel blending.
This training aims at improving the attendees’ knowledge and understanding of the principles of operation and decision-making involved in the management of refinery offsite operations, such as crude / fuels (Gasoline, Diesel, Fuel Oil) blending control and optimization, tanks farm management, terminal and custody transfer, oil movement etc.
Advanced process control strategies invariably use linear and non-linear programming methods to solve complex and non-unique process models solutions. These techniques are employed in refinery planning, blend recipe formulations, optimum operating parameters for process units, etc.
